Adding a screen is relatively straightforward, the complexity really depends on which OS you'll be running.
I'd suggest using a screen which uses the DSI interface, as these are pretty much plug'n'play. THe original RPi 7" screen uses this interface, but you can get 3.5", 4.3" and 5" versions from Waveshare.
